How to Shadow a Word in Cricut Design Space
If you’re a craft enthusiast who loves to create custom designs with your Cricut machine, you might have wondered how to add a shadow effect to a word. Shadows can give your projects a professional and polished look, adding depth and dimension to your designs. In this article, we’ll guide you through the steps to shadow a word in Cricut Design Space, making your crafting projects stand out.
Step 1: Open Cricut Design Space
First, open the Cricut Design Space software on your computer or mobile device. If you haven’t already downloaded the software, you can do so for free from the Cricut website. Once you’ve logged in, you’ll be ready to start creating your shadowed word.
Step 2: Select the Text Tool
In the Cricut Design Space, you’ll find a variety of tools to help you create your design. To shadow a word, start by selecting the “Text” tool. You can do this by clicking on the “Text” button on the left-hand side of the screen or by pressing the “T” key on your keyboard.
Step 3: Type Your Word
Once the text tool is selected, simply type the word you want to shadow into the text box. You can adjust the font, size, and color of the word to your preference. If you have a specific font in mind, you can search for it in the font library or upload a custom font.
Step 4: Duplicate the Text
To create the shadow effect, you’ll need to duplicate the text. Click on the word you’ve typed, then press “Ctrl+C” (or “Cmd+C” on a Mac) to copy it. Next, press “Ctrl+V” (or “Cmd+V”) to paste the word onto the canvas. This will create a second instance of the word, which will serve as the shadow.
Step 5: Position the Shadow
Select the shadow layer by clicking on it. Then, use the arrow keys on your keyboard to move the shadow layer slightly below and to the right of the original word. This will create the desired shadow effect. You can adjust the position of the shadow to your liking by dragging it with your mouse.
